It got me thinking about how this day and other lunatic
ideas got to be listed as a celebration. Turns out, all you have to do is
register your holiday with the US Copyright office. The next step is to get it
into the book – Chase’s Calendar of Events. Those folks are fussy however, and in
order to get a listing, you have to prove it is a real day. You’ll need
documentation, or photos, or theme parties, something to prove it is not theoretical.
